C2131

No Signal From Transmitter ID 1 In 2nd Mode

C2131 is an OBD-II diagnostic trouble code meaning: No Signal From Transmitter ID 1 In 2nd Mode. Common causes: broken or damaged wiring harness, transmitter id 1 fault. Estimated repair cost: $56–222.

Severity
🔴 High
Can you drive?
Do not drive — repair immediately
Approx. repair cost
$56–222 (est.)

Symptoms

  • Airbag light is on
  • Seat belt pretensioners do not work
  • Error C2131 in the control unit memory

Causes

  • Broken or damaged wiring harness
  • Transmitter ID 1 fault
  • Problems with the restraint system control unit
  • Contact corrosion
  • Control unit software error

How to Fix

  1. Check the integrity of the wiring harness
  2. Check the status of transmitter ID 1
  3. Check contacts for corrosion
  4. Update or reflash the control unit if necessary
  5. Replace faulty components
